Dark-mode in the Cindertrack admin dashboard is theme-token driven. Tokens resolve at render via the Palettier service; no hardcoded colors remain as of v4.2. Overrides live in `themes/dark.json` and hot-reload in dev. The dashboard queries Palettier for tenant-level theme flags on boot, falling back to system preference if the call fails. Do not cache flag responses beyond 60 seconds. Palettier requires authentication on every request; the current key is below.

gateway credential: kto23_LX9A4ys6i4nzHtpOLNLodKK

**Ticket GT-412: Turnstile counter double-increments on fast rotations**

The Gatewise counter at Ashfield Arena records two entries when a turnstile completes rotation in under 400ms. Suspected debounce issue in the sensor polling loop. New team members: reproduce on the bench rig before touching firmware, and attach counter logs to this ticket. The affected build's trace token appears below.

pipeline stamp: htk9_ce63042d9

// Client setup for EchoHall, the museum audio-guide backend.
// Context for weekly sync: we moved tour manifests off the CDN
// and onto the internal Curator service, so the client now needs
// auth on every manifest fetch. Retries capped at 3, timeout 5s.
// Don't bump concurrency past 8 — Curator rate-limits hard.
// Staging and prod use separate keys; this block is staging only.
// The Curator staging key goes directly below this comment.

service key, kawip-kahop: kto4_QQzB

**Onboarding note — temporary site, Ashgrove Wharf**

While Penderly House is under renovation, all reception duties transfer to the temporary site at Ashgrove Wharf, Unit 4. Please note the differences carefully: there is no turnstile, so every visitor must be signed in manually and escorted beyond the lobby; deliveries go to the rear shutter, not the front door; and the fire assembly point is the riverside courtyard. The front door remains locked at all times, even during office hours, and staff enter using the keypad code.

turnstile pass: bdg-NG-3